A balloon lifts off the ground and reaches a height of 200m. The total mass of the balloon is 1000 kg. What is the GPE of the balloon?

Answers

Answer:

1,960,000Joules

Step-by-step explanation:

Gravitational Potential Energy is expressed as;

GPE = mgh

m is the mass

g is the acceleration due to gravity

h is the height

Given

m = 1000kg

h = 200m

g = 9.8m/s

Substitute;

GPE  = 1000 * 9.8 * 200

GPE = 9800 * 200

GPE = 1,960,000Joules

Hence the GPE of the balloon is 1,960,000Joules

The foot of a ladder is placed 18 feet from a wall. If the top of the ladder
rests 24 feet up on the wall, find the length of the ladder.
26 feet
27 feet
29 feet
O 30 feet

Answers

Answer:

I'm not sure

I think its 30 or 26

Step-by-step explanation:

Answer:

30 feet

Step-by-step explanation:

The ladder laying against the wall will create a right triangle.

The side lengths will be 18 and 24 and you will solve for the hypoteneuse which will be the length of the latter.

You can use the pythagorean theorm so

[tex]a^{2} +b^{2} =c^{2}[/tex] so you plug in the values

[tex]18^{2}+24^{2} =c^{2} \\324+576=c^{2} \\900=c^{2} \\\sqrt{900} =\sqrt{c^{2} } \\30=c[/tex]

A right square pyramid has a base with sides that are 2 inches in length and a slant height of 7 inches. If the lengths of the sides of the base and the slant height are multiplied by 7, by what factor is the surface area multiplied? A. 7 B. 14 C. 28 D. 49

Answers

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

base b = 2 in

slant height L = 7 in

lateral area = 4·½bL = 4·½·2·7 = 28 in²

base area = b² = 4 in²

surface area = 28+4 = 32 in²

If b = 14 and L = 49:

lateral area = 4·½·14·49 = 1372 in²

base area =  196 in²,

and surface area = 1372+196 = 1568 in²

The surface area has multiplied by 49.
